Warren Buffett's Way: When it comes to stock, it's about management, management, management

Warren Buffett puts strong management on the top of his
list. He likes to meet them in person and get to know them. That’s a
little too much to ask of you. But, at minimum, you should read the
CEO’s bio (which is typically provided on a company’s website).

Warren Buffett googles the CEO’s name. Nine times out of 10, you’ll get plenty ofinstant reading material.

If you can, go to the company’s annual meetings and listen to the CEO and other executives speak. Or – if
that’s not possible – listen to their called-in quarterly earnings report.

Just remember that there’s no such thing as too much direct and upclose
exposure to the companies you’re investing in. The more you
know about them, the better buy/sell decisions you will make.
